Atangi - Gopiballavpur - I, Jhargram

Atangi is a village situated in the Gopiballavpur - I subdivision of Jhargram district, West Bengal. Amarda serves as the Gram Panchayat for Atangi village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Atangi is 340639. The village covers a total geographical area of 122.29 hectares and falls under the 721506 pincode. Jhargram is the nearest town, located about 60 km away.

Atangi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Pradhan serving as the elected head.

Population of Atangi

According to the 2011 Census, Atangi village had a total population of 1,185 people, including 619 males and 566 females, living in 281 households. The sex ratio was 914 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 69.22%, with male literacy at 79.71% and female literacy at 57.81%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 492,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 61.

Transport and Connectivity of Atangi

Atangi is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 5-10 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Rajalukah, while the nearest airport is Sonari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 74.7 km.
